Gets or sets the value of the input. This example demonstrates the Checkbox Selection in Blazor DataGrid Component. The Toolbar component can display checked and unchecked buttons (items). In the above code we are basically loading the CheckBoxList on page load with a list of Employee object which is a custom class. You can get the code from here. This worked, your right I was painfully close haha. How to add checkbox in the MultiSelect dropdown. Imagine you need to ensure at least one checkbox is checked from a group of checkboxes. What is this political cartoon by Bob Moran titled "Amnesty" about? in your @Code, bool checkedValue = false; // or true if it suits your use case.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. Or, by setting TriState="true", you can get the Indeterminate state after the False state. Blazor Checkbox Overview. In the following example, the check icon can be customized by changing check icon content, background and border color in focus and hovered states by adding e-checkicon class. As you've probably noticed unlike most of the input elements that are bound to their value attribute, the input checkbox is bound to with the *checked** attribute, The value attribute store the value that should be posted to the database@. You can raise issues, create pull requests or even fork the content . To subscribe to this RSS feed, copy and paste this URL into your RSS reader. To create a binding from the control to the variable, you should add the @onchange directive with an event handler that gets a new value from the system and update the ticked variable. Can FOSS software licenses (e.g. This didn't work for me until I also used the checked attribute -- note that checked can still bind to a function e.g. Gets or sets a collection of additional attributes that will be applied to the created element. Data Type. The third author isn't on the list yet, so click the Add author button. There are many other ways to do this, but hopefully you can get the idea.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. H. Checked State. Like I said this works, when I click the checkbox it will change the boolean in the database through the API, but the checkbox will not be checked when viewing completed items. bool, bool? Unchecked State.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Change the textbox input control's text and then change control focus. Asking for help, clarification, or responding to other answers. <DxCheckBox Checked="@Checked" CheckedChanged="@ ((bool value) => CheckedChanged . Did find rhyme with joined in the 18th century? Material Design Checkboxes for Blazor, allow the user to select multiple options from a set. Check it out! Name for phenomenon in which attempting to solve a problem locally can seemingly fail because they absorb the problem from elsewhere? Thanks Buddy. MIT, Apache, GNU, etc.) However, I have no idea how to transfer data from one page to another. How can I retrieve multiple checkbox values from checkboxes added dynamically in Blazor when using EditForm and/or @bind-Value? If any more info is needed please let me Know!! The demo above shows some of its key features. Find centralized, trusted content and collaborate around the technologies you use most. The CheckBox content is aligned to the center of component's root . Add this property to the @function block or a class derived from BlazorCoponent: Now the value of your check box is bound to the name property Does English have an equivalent to the Aramaic idiom "ashes on my head"? By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Thanks for contributing an answer to Stack Overflow! The Checkbox component is part of Telerik UI for Blazor, a professional grade UI library with 95+ native components for building . How to print the current filename with a function defined in another file? it does not compile, because of "checked attribute is set twice" error. Keep a separate list for selected items, and add or remove them in the event handler for the checkbox. Connect and share knowledge within a single location that is structured and easy to search. Open ~/_Imports.razor file or any other page under the ~/Pages folder where the component is to be added and import the Syncfusion.Blazor.Buttons namespace. I also tried using value which would be my approach with a text input type but it doesn't work on checkboxes. @TimDavis Great suggestion, except your "checked" did not work for me in Blazor. Pattern model has 4 parts PatternID the PK PatternName, PatternType and Inactive which is just for future implementation. Model Binding in Blazor CheckBox Component. Stop requiring only one assertion per unit test: Multiple assertions are fine, Going from engineer to entrepreneur takes more than just good code (Ep. Step 3. Essential Studio for Blazor . The CheckBox content is aligned to the right of the component's root element. Demonstration and configuration of the Radzen Blazor CheckBox component. rev2022.11.7.43014. Platform: Blazor | Category : Data binding, Event handling To get the checkbox value when it is checked or unchecked use the onchange event by calling a method in onchange event using lambda expression and passing the checkbox value to it. Learn more about the Telerik Blazor CheckBox and its Validation abilities. a basic checkbox is initialized with Checked property. Wired up the OnInput event. I've just recently begun learning how to create websites using the Blazor template. The Checkbox will be useful in the scenario where there is a need to select multiple options. The value of checkedValue will have the same value as your checkbox. Three authors wrote the book. . <SfCheckBox Checked="true"> </SfCheckBox> Constructors . Stop requiring only one assertion per unit test: Multiple assertions are fine, Going from engineer to entrepreneur takes more than just good code (Ep. If he wanted control of the company, why didn't Elon Musk buy 51% of Twitter shares instead of 100%? The Checked property specifies the button's state. This is about Futuristic Blazor application architecture. 1. What is the difference between .NET Core and .NET Standard Class Library project types? When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. How do planetarium apps and software calculate positions? this is probably easy, but i'm kind of stuck. Custom check icon. Will it have a bad influence on getting a student visa? There are many other ways to do this, but hopefully you can get the idea. bool . My particular scenario is similar to Mike's in that I need the change event of the checkbox to drive whether another component is visible. The Radzen Blazor component library provides more than 70 UI controls for building rich ASP.NET Core web applications. Does English have an equivalent to the Aramaic idiom "ashes on my head"? public bool name {get;set;}, and then you can use the @bind-value attr, , or you can use the InputCheckbox built in component, , https://learn.microsoft.com/en-us/aspnet/core/blazor/forms-validation?view=aspnetcore-5.0#built-in-forms-components, *forgot mentioning the InputCheckbox has to be inside a EditForm. I'm reading data from a DB and need a chekbox to reflect the current status of a bool, I can get the status in code but cant figur out how to add or remove the "checked" property of the checkbox input. Connect and share knowledge within a single location that is structured and easy to search. It is recommended to use Smart.CheckBox in forms with multiple options and Smart.SwitchButton in single settings option. Watch Video: Data Grid - Column Customization. Notice a message gets printed in the Debug window in the Output tab of Visual Studio (Expected behavior) Substituting black beans for ground beef in a meat pie. The button will wait until. Add a comment. The CheckBox content is aligned to the left of the component's root element. Connect and share knowledge within a single location that is structured and easy to search. Not the answer you're looking for? because when I remove the value part, there is no value to get, You are binding to @name, so that will hold the value. Like I said this works, when I click the checkbox it will change the boolean in the database through the API, but the checkbox will not be checked when viewing completed items. How does DNS work when it comes to addresses after slash? The "Select all available equipment" box is an example of event handling. How can you prove that a certain file was downloaded from a certain website? This video I will talk how to use checkbox and databinding in .NET 6.0 Blazor Application. Blazor-university has good explanation. Which finite projective planes can have a symmetric incidence matrix? Asking for help, clarification, or responding to other answers. TriState CheckBox. Override the theme styles and change the default font icon glyphs. The state changes each time a user clicks a CheckBox: Indeterminate -> Checked -> Unchecked -> Indeterminate. The DxDataGridCheckBoxColumn displays disabled checkboxes that support the checked, unchecked, and indeterminate states. Would a bicycle pump work underwater, with its air-input being above water? By default, users can select and unselect rows by clicking anywhere on them. .NET Core Blazor App: How to pass data between pages? Bind the checkbox value to a bool value. Why should you not leave the inputs of unused gates floating with 74LS series logic? This is just the bare bones of the dialog box that uses the mechanism in my case: From there, if you do need to do some more processing when the checkbox change event is triggered; you can add a method that does the relevant processing and switches the value of isChecked accordingly. 1 Answer. Dedicated . 1. I feel like using bind is the way to go but I cannot figure out how to pick up the checkbox selection when using bind. Should I avoid attending certain conferences? I have kept the Employee class in the same file just to save it; in the actual project it will be part of your Models Folder/project. Replace first 7 lines of one file with content of another file. Stack Overflow for Teams is moving to its own domain! Will Nondetection prevent an Alarm spell from triggering? So My real question is how do I approach setting up these input check box? Thanks in advance, here is what I am doing currently which does not show checked in the completed view. Thursday 09 Jul 2020. Running into an issue where I am not sure how to handle a checkbox click since I cannot use both @bind and @onchange in the same form control. Of course you can use the @bind directive to create a two-way data-binding like this: Note that you cannot use the @onchange directive with the @bind directive because the @bind directive is a compiler directive telling the compiler to create the binding as I did manually in the first input, and of course you are not allowed to have two @onchange attributes. What's the best way to roleplay a Beholder shooting with its many rays at a Major Image illusion? How do I modify the URL without reloading the page? Name for phenomenon in which attempting to solve a problem locally can seemingly fail because they absorb the problem from elsewhere? Create a carrier class to hold your list items with an added IsSelected variable. Consequences resulting from Yitang Zhang's latest claimed results on Landau-Siegel zeros. Add Blazor CheckBox component. Copy Paste the following code in CbListEx.razor file. Light bulb as limit, to what is current limited to? DevExpress CheckBox for Blazor (DxCheckBox) supports the checked, unchecked, and indeterminate (optional) states.To switch the state, users can click the checkbox or press SPACE when the checkbox is focused.. Add a CheckBox to a Project. In this article you will learn how to Create a Checkbox List in Blazor. note: you can't do this: @onchange="@function1()" The value assigned to the @onchange directive should be a lambda expression, as for instance: You should use parentheses only if you are going to pass a value to function1, like this: @onchange="@(() => function1 (true))". Enter the author order and click the checkbox as shown in the figure above. I couldn't figured it out how to get the checked value. Does a beard adversely affect playing the violin or viola? To learn more, see our tips on writing great answers. Does subclassing int to forbid negative integers break Liskov Substitution Principle? Add the following code in NavMenu.razor inside the Shared folder to add a menu item for opening CbListEx.razor page. Get the size of the screen, current web page and browser window. They're a bit tricky, but very useful. Thanks for contributing an answer to Stack Overflow! In the above code we are just showing the bound CheckBoxList, a button to show the selected values in a Label.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Open the BlazorComponents Project, right click on the Shared folder and select Option Add => Razor Component like below screenshot. Or, if you don't want to make a bool variable, you can pass the item through to your event handler and keep a separate list of selected items. Specifies an inline style for an DOM element. 29 Jul 2022 2 minutes to read. How to split a page into four areas in tex. Add the CheckBox component to the Pages/Index.razor file.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Is this meat that I was told was brisket in Barcelona the same as U.S. brisket? You can add the CheckBox to Blazor's standard EditForm component to validate the Checked property value. @using Syncfusion.Blazor.Buttons <SfCheckBox Label="Buy Groceries . Share. when using onchange u can't use bind, se the accepted answere for more info. When I do this it will check the checkbox on completed items but will not pick it up when it is clicked. A checkbox needs to be bound to a bool variable. Want a place to play, experiment, share & learn using Blazor? Did the words "come" and "home" historically rhyme? 503), Mobile app infrastructure being decommissioned, Create Generic method constraining T to an Enum. 1,071 4 4 silver badges 19 19 bronze . What is the rationale of climate activists pouring soup on Van Gogh paintings of sunflowers? Is it possible for a gas fired boiler to consume more energy when heating intermitently versus having heating at all times? What's the proper value for a checked attribute of an HTML checkbox? Run Demo: Data Grid - Column Types. How to understand "round up" in this context? Can an adult sue someone who violated them as a child? Then inspect the code and try to understand how it should be done in Blazor, what is the problem with bind? Are certain conferences or fields "allocated" to certain universities? Can someone please help me out and explain how I would handle the checkbox dynamically being checked or uncheck and also bind the boolean to it?
Beauty Standards In Bulgaria,
Likelihood Function For Poisson Distribution,
Does Daedalus Stack With Coup De Grace,
Read Text File From S3 Python,
Awgn Channel Capacity,
Kayseri Airport To Nevsehir,
Business Central Create Json Object,
Pytest Test Case Example,
River Cruise Spain And Portugal,
International Drivers License Switzerland,
Maximum Likelihood Estimation Exponential Distribution Python,
Cirque Berserk Winter Wonderland,
Qt Leak Stopper Roof Patch,